Common Commercial Roof Emergencies That Strike Denver Buildings
Denver’s harsh climate subjects commercial buildings to severe weather that can cause sudden roof failures. Storm damage scenarios frequently overwhelm local commercial roofing contractors during peak seasons. Hailstorms deliver golf ball-sized ice that punctures membrane systems and cracks protective coatings on flat roofs. High winds exceeding 60 mph can lift entire roof sections, tear flashing loose, and drive debris through roofing materials with devastating force.
Heavy snow accumulation creates additional stress on commercial structures, particularly when combined with freeze-thaw cycles that expand and contract roofing materials. These conditions often trigger roof leak emergencies when structural components fail under the excessive weight. Business owners frequently discover water intrusion only after significant damage has occurred to interior spaces and equipment.
Sudden leaks can develop rapidly and require immediate flat roof emergency services to prevent business shutdowns. Aging roof membranes can split without warning, allowing water into insulation and ceiling systems. Equipment malfunctions such as HVAC unit failures can also compromise roof integrity, creating urgent repair needs that threaten daily operations.
Structural failures represent the most serious emergencies, potentially endangering employee safety and requiring immediate evacuation. When commercial buildings experience beam deflection, membrane separation, or drainage system collapse, 24-hour roof repair becomes essential to protect lives and property from further damage.
Taking Immediate Action When Disaster Strikes Your Roof
When a commercial roof emergency occurs, the first priority is to ensure employee and customer safety. Business owners should immediately evacuate affected areas and establish a safety perimeter around any visible structural damage. Moving equipment, inventory, and important documents away from leaks prevents additional losses while waiting for professionals to arrive. Temporary containment measures such as strategically placed buckets and tarps can help redirect water flow away from critical business operations.
Documenting the damage is necessary for insurance claims and provides Denver contractors with accurate information to assess the situation. Taking photographs from multiple angles captures the extent of damage both inside and outside the building. Recording the time of discovery, weather conditions, and any immediate actions taken creates a comprehensive record that supports claim processing and helps commercial roofing contractors understand the scope of the damage.
Contacting emergency services should happen simultaneously with damage documentation. Reputable contractors offering 24-hour roof repair services can provide an immediate assessment and temporary stabilization. Professional crews can install emergency tarping systems and temporary drainage solutions that protect the building until permanent repairs can be completed.
Communication with employees, customers, and insurance representatives keeps all stakeholders informed about the situation. Flat roof emergency services often require coordinating with multiple parties to ensure business continuity while addressing safety concerns. Quick action during the first hours after a commercial roof emergency can significantly reduce total damage costs and minimize business disruption.

Flat Roof Systems and Emergency Repair Challenges
Flat roofs dominate Denver’s commercial landscape due to their cost-effectiveness and space utilization benefits, but these systems present distinct emergency repair challenges that require specialized expertise. Unlike sloped roofing systems that naturally shed water, flat roofs rely entirely on properly functioning drainage systems to prevent water accumulation. When emergency commercial roof repair contractors respond to flat roof failures, they typically encounter complicated scenarios that involve more than just the main leak.
The low-slope design of flat roofing systems creates potential ponding areas where water can collect and infiltrate through even minor membrane defects. During commercial roof leak repairs, standing water often masks the actual leak source, making rapid diagnosis more complex than traditional peaked roof repairs. Membrane materials used in flat roof construction can develop sudden splits, punctures, or seam failures that allow water to leak in across large surface areas.
Drainage system failures are one of the most critical flat roof emergencies that require quick professional intervention. Blocked drains, damaged gutters, or failed scuppers can transform routine rainfall into building-threatening water accumulation within hours. These complex emergency situations often require services with specialized pumping equipment and temporary drainage solutions to prevent complete roof collapse.
Commercial roofing contractors understand that membrane repair techniques differ significantly from conventional roofing methods, requiring specific materials and application procedures suited for urgent situations.
Preventing Future Roofing Emergencies Through Smart Planning
Proactive maintenance strategies significantly reduce the likelihood of roofing emergencies during severe weather. Regular inspections allow property managers to identify potential problems before they need urgent repair. Commercial roof leaks often develop gradually through small membrane defects, loose flashing, or compromised seals that trained professionals can address during routine maintenance visits.
Routine maintenance should involve scheduling quarterly inspections that examine all roof system components, including drainage elements, membrane integrity, and seals. Professional commercial roofing contractors typically recommend seasonal maintenance checks following Denver’s harsh winter and before summer storms begin. These preventive measures help spot weather-related damage early when repairs remain cost-effective and manageable.
Building relationships with qualified contractors before emergencies occur ensures a rapid response when urgent situations develop. Reputable companies offering 24-hour roof repair services often provide priority response to existing maintenance clients, reducing wait times during peak demand. Pre-established service agreements can include emergency protocols, contact procedures, and predetermined authorization levels that expedite storm damage roof repair when time becomes critical.
Building owners should also keep detailed information about their roof system on hand, including warranty documents, previous repair records, and manufacturer specifications. This information helps flat roof emergency services teams quickly assess system compatibility and select appropriate repair materials. Emergency response plans should include building evacuation procedures, temporary protection measures, and communication protocols that minimize business disruption when roofing emergencies threaten operations.
